The Rhode Island Department of Health is hosting three community meetings to hear public comment on Memorial Hospital’s proposal to cease providing inpatient obstetrics services.

The community meetings will be held on the following dates at the following locations:

– March 14th at Goff Junior High School – Vine Street entrance, 974 Newport Avenue, Pawtucket; 5:00 PM to 7:00 PM

– March 16th at Woodlawn Community Center, 210 West Avenue, Pawtucket; 11:00 AM to 1:00 PM

– March 17th at Segue Institute for Learning – Hedley Avenue entrance, 325 Cowden Street, Central Falls; 4:00 PM to 6:00 PM

Last week, Memorial Hospital notified RIDOH of its proposal to stop providing inpatient obstetrics services, and to transfer those services to Women & Infants Hospital and Kent County Memorial Hospital.

Memorial Hospital was told that obstetrical services must remain open, fully staffed, and fully functional until a decision has been made by RIDOH on the proposal.

The public can also email comments to RIDOH or submit comments via postal mail. Comments will be accepted through March 25th. More information about how to email or mail comments to RIDOH can be found at: www.health.ri.gov/memorial.
